Description

"Day cap, entirely hand stitched linen, edged all around with a narrow-hemmed 1” muslin frill. The cap is flat and basic with a circle crown enlarged slightly with a pieced triangular section added to its base. Also pieced near crown with exquisitely fine seam. Short, woven linen ties. Small size, perhaps one- or two-year old.Overall height in center as viewed, about 6.5”Inked inscription on proper right corner, difficult to decipher: “Emma D. Balsh 2 yrs 1853.” ?? Could it be 1833?"
